Stupak On The Stupak Amendment

Rep. Bart Stupak's (D-MI) abortion amendment, which passed Saturday night has set off a firestorm of criticism from pro-choice lawmakers and interest groups, and it's being viewed as a coup for pro-lifers in Congress.

In an interview today, Stupak said his amendment does nothing more than apply current abortion law (the annually renewed Hyde amendment) to health care reform, and that pro-choice Democrats have only themselves to blame for its passage on the House floor Saturday night.

The amendment prohibits federal subsidies from being used to purchase insurance plans that cover elective abortions.

Speaker Pelosi went to present what she agreed to with us, that it would be part of a manager's amendment. There never should have been a vote on this. We had agreed to put it in a manager's amendment, which would have been less than what I actually got--Hyde-lite as I call it, Hyde language lite--and it was the pro-choice people that rejected it. read whole interview
